4 times the measure of the complement of an angle is equal to 2/3 the measure of the original angles supplement. what is the mea
Irina-Kira [14]
Let angle be x 
4 times complement = 4(90 - x)
2/3 times its supplement = 2/3(180 - x)

4(90 - x) = 2/3 (180 - x)
360 - 4x = 120 - 2/3 x
240 =  3 1/3 x
x =  240  /  10/3  = 240 * 3/10  = 72 degrees Answer

When a book of 100 pages is opened, the sum of the facing page numbers can be divided by 5, the quotient is a product of 3 and 7
statuscvo [17]
Sum means the result of addition.
Quotient means the result of division.
Product means the result of multiplication.

The product of 3 and 7 is 21, because:
3 × 7 = 21

Therefore, the quotient is 21.

Let the sum of the facing page numbers = x:
Therefore, x/5 = 21
Rearranging the equation to find x (the sum of the facing page numbers) gives us:
x = 21 × 5
= 105
So the sum of the facing page numbers is 105.

The only two adjacent numbers which add up to 105 are 52 and 53, so the facing page numbers must be 52 and 53.
